Job Overview
Black Horse Kettle Corn, LLC is seeking enthusiastic and adaptable individuals to join our dynamic Farmers Market and Event Team. As a team member, you'll play a vital role in representing our brand at various local markets and events. You'll be involved in all aspects of our operations, from preparing and packaging our delicious products to providing exceptional customer service and maintaining a clean and organized booth. We're looking for individuals who are eager to learn, work well independently and as part of a team, and thrive in a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ities
- Assist with the setup and breakdown of event booth, including equipment, supplies and market booth components.
- Prepare and package kettle corn and lemonade according to company recipes and standards.
- Provide friendly, efficient, and exceptional customer service by engaging with guests and answering their questions.
- Address guest needs and resolve any customer inquiries or issues promptly and professionally.
- Handle transactions accurately and efficiently using POS systems.
- Communicate effectively with team members and event coordinators to ensure seamless operations.
- Follow directions from the Market Stand Manager and company representatives.
- Monitor event activities to ensure compliance with safety regulations and company policies.
- Promote products or services through upselling techniques to enhance guest experience.
- Maintain product knowledge.
- Maintain cleanliness and organization of event space and market booth throughout the duration of the event.
- Supervise junior staff members as needed, providing guidance and support during events.
- Be willing to work in various weather conditions.
- Travel to various locations within a 2-hour radius of Montgomery County.
Qualifications
- Must be 18 years of age or older.
- Valid driver's license and reliable personal transportation.
- Ability to work weekends and flexible hours.
- Ability to drive a truck and trailer, with a clean driving record is highly desirable.
- Must obtain a ServSafe Food Handler certification within 60 days of employment.
- Ability to lift and carry up to 50 pounds.
- Ability to follow directions accurately and work efficiently.
- Must be responsible, punctual, and dependable.
- Must have a positive attitude and be respectful.
- Excellent customer service and communication skills.
- Ability to work effectively both independently and as part of a team.
- Willingness to learn and adapt to different roles, responsibilities, and event environments.
- Experience with cash handling is a plus.
- Experience with POS systems is preferred but not required; training will be provided.
- Bilingual in Spanish and English is highly desirable.
- Ability to work well under pressure in a fast-paced environment while maintaining attention to detail.
- Ability to supervise others effectively when required.
